Output 6c509c7d368e71be2d6e9b5bee68477136aeb92bad8b4c6f88a104a4201e0dff:7

value
17563086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d690b936d1d1e41479374827efdd859d703b50 OP_EQUAL
address
MCoq5rgcbnH2xrRVAFp18vFKdT3DcGxwuE
transaction
6c509c7d368e71be2d6e9b5bee68477136aeb92bad8b4c6f88a104a4201e0dff
spent
true